Cairo (Egypt), 12/05/2018.- A general view of a street with Ramadans ornaments, Baragel, on the outskirts of Cairo, Egypt, 12 May 2018 (Issued 13 May 2018). People put up decorations and ornaments in the local tradition in Egypt as part of the celebration of the Holy month of Ramadan, which is expected to start in Egypt on 17 May 2018. ?Muslims around the world celebrate the holy month of Ramadan by praying during the night time and abstaining from eating, drinking, and sexual acts during the period between sunrise and sunset. Ramadan is the ninth month in the Islamic calendar and it is believed that the revelation of the first verse in Koran was during its last 10 nights. (Egipto) EFE/EPA/MOHAMED HOSSAM
